Output e320c6a031c0b40f17c59ee7608bddef0f7e22dd69a35ca6239cda61fdf2d257:1

value
1013280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816c451c5cde3463dbf0e2c8d80947c56695c1f2 OP_EQUAL
address
3DVLo23hhBL6nnHbAoaLSQeFR7YJC9FQ9f
transaction
e320c6a031c0b40f17c59ee7608bddef0f7e22dd69a35ca6239cda61fdf2d257
spent
true